An Intel Core 2 Duo Q6867 CPU is required at a minimum to run Type & Magic. In terms of game file size, you will need at least 400 MB of free disk space available. The minimum memory requirement for Type & Magic is 2 GB of RAM installed in your computer. The cheapest graphics card you can play it on is an Intel HD 3000.

Type & Magic will run on PC system with Windows 10/11 and upwards. Additionally it has a Linux version.

Type & Magic Linux system requirements (minimum)

  • Memory:2 GB
  • Graphics Card:ATI FireGL T2-128
  • CPU:Intel Core 2 Duo Q6867
  • File Size:400 MB
  • OS:Ubuntu 18.04+ (64-bit) or compatible distro

What is Type & Magic?

Type words to shape your path, solve puzzles, and explore the ruins of a dead wizard’s castle. Find artifacts to uncover the castle’s dark mysteries. Report everything you saw to your master. Or… don’t.
